This paper is dedicated to the analysis of the effectiveness of the training of security administrators concerning the work with information security systems. Assessment of the effectiveness was carried out by measuring the time taken by the administrator to perform typical operations. According to the results obtained, the reduction of time expenditures differs significantly for different types of operations and depends on the initial level of administrator’s skills. Measuring the operation execution time allows to build an optimal training strategy–to pay maximum attention to master skills in the operations, for which the time savings are maximum when moving to the next skill level. The proposed strategy of specialist training will make it possible to improve the efficiency of the digital educational environment with the use of innovative technologies.
